> Overall -1 > > -1 Package naming: we use two different naming schemes for RPMs vs. DEBs. > - in debs the clients are aurora-tools, the executor is aurora-executor, > and the scheduler is aurora-scheduler. In the RPM version the scheduler is > aurora, the clients are aurora-client, and the executor is aurora-thermos. > I think converging the two naming schemes now before our first "official > packages" will save our community a lot of cognitive overhead in the long > run. No strong opinions here as long as they're consistent, but the debian > names seem closer to reality (except aurora-tools, which seems like it > should be aurora-client). > Filed https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/AURORA-1477 > > +0 Packaging test instructions - provision.sh installs a bunch of packages > out-of-band. Part of testing whether packages work should be installing > them in minimal system to ensure their dependencies are complete IMO. It > looks like the mesos needs to be installed out-of-band first, but zookeeper > can wait until after the it's verified that the aurora packages install. > @wfarner, would you like a pull request for the testing documentation here? > > +0 Package dependencies - aurora (scheduler package) depends on > java-1.8.0-openjdk but can be set to depend on java-1.8.0 instead, allowing > folks to easily substitute jdks from their favorite vendors in the standard > way.
